In announcing Princess Eugenie‘s third pregnancy through official channels, Buckingham Palace has made ‘a terrible mistake’, prematurely signalling to the public that the King wants Andrew and Fergie’s daughters to remain part of the Royal fold, Richard Eden has said on Palace Confidential.
Speaking on the podcast alongside co-host Rebecca English, the Daily Mail’s Diary Editor said the Palace should keep Eugenie and Beatrice at ‘arm’s length’ while the investigation into their father continues.
